Choose the Right Time of Year
The most comfortable time for a Nile cruise is between October and April, when the weather is pleasant for exploring temples and enjoying long hours on the sundeck.
If you travel during the warmer months, plan outdoor sightseeing early in the morning and spend the hottest part of the day relaxing onboard.
Pack for Comfort, Not Fashion
You’ll spend more time walking through temples than sitting at dinner.
Bring:
- Comfortable walking shoes
- Lightweight clothing
- Sunglasses and a hat
- Sunscreen
- A reusable water bottle
- A light jacket for cool evenings
Simple choices like these can make every excursion much more enjoyable.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the best time to take a Nile cruise in Egypt?
The best time is between October and April, when temperatures are cooler and sightseeing is more comfortable.
How many days should a Nile cruise be?
A 5 to 7-day cruise offers the ideal balance between relaxation, cultural exploration, and scenic sailing, while longer itineraries provide an even deeper experience.
Is a Dahabiya better than a large Nile cruise ship?
If you value privacy, personalized service, and access to hidden locations, a luxury Dahabiya offers a more intimate and authentic Nile experience.
What should I pack for a Nile cruise?
Pack lightweight clothing, comfortable walking shoes, sunscreen, sunglasses, a hat, a reusable water bottle, and a light jacket for cooler evenings.
